Noble Group hunts investor as profit seen up to two years away
SINGAPORE (Sept 19): Noble Group Ltd. is still seeking a strategic investor as the founder and chairman of the embattled Asian commodities trader says it will take as much as two years for a return to profit.
“A strategic partner is still very possible,” Richard Elman, who is due to stand down as executive chairman by June, said in an interview at the company’s headquarters in Hong Kong. “But it has to be at the right time and the right candidate.”
